Load in PPSSPP: Open the emulator, navigate to the folder where you extracted the file, and tap the game icon. 💡 Pro Tips for Performance

CSO vs. ISO: CSO files are smaller but can sometimes cause "stuttering" on older hardware because the CPU has to decompress data while you play.

Frame Skipping: If a game runs slowly, enable "Frame Skipping" in the PPSSPP settings.

Rendering Resolution: Keep the resolution at 1x PSP for the best performance on low-end devices.

The Ultimate Guide to Highly Compressed PPSSPP Games Under 50MB

Finding high-quality games that don't eat up your storage can be a challenge, especially for mobile gamers using the PPSSPP emulator. "Highly compressed" games are versions of original titles—originally ranging from 500MB to over 1GB—that have been reduced in size through advanced compression techniques or by removing non-essential files like high-resolution textures and background music. : A strategy game with a small file size often recommended for low-storage builds. How Highly Compressed Files Work

Compression involves converting standard .ISO game files into more efficient formats:

CSO (Compressed ISO): The most common format. Using a tool like ISO Compressor, users can select a compression level (usually 1–9) to shrink files. Level 9 provides the maximum space savings.

CHD: A newer, more efficient compression format supported by current versions of PPSSPP that often yields better results than CSO.

Removing Assets: Extreme "high compression" often involves stripping non-essential data like cutscenes (.PMF files), high-quality audio, or multi-language support. 💡 Key Performance Notes

Loading Times: Highly compressed CSO files may have slightly longer loading times because the emulator must decompress data on the fly.

Compatibility: Ensure your emulator version is up to date, as modern builds handle compressed formats like CHD much better than older versions.

File Formats: PPSSPP natively supports .ISO, .CSO, .CHD, and .PBP formats. It does not play games directly from .ZIP or .RAR files; these must be extracted first.
